2-Methyl-2-[4-(1-methylethyl)phenoxy]propanoyl chloride

Description:
2-Methyl-2-[4-(1-methylethyl)phenoxy]propanoyl chloride is an organic compound characterized by its functional groups and structural features. It contains a propanoyl chloride moiety, which indicates the presence of a carbonyl group (C=O) adjacent to a chlorine atom, making it a reactive acyl chloride. The compound also features a phenoxy group, which is derived from phenol, indicating that it has a phenyl ring substituted with an isopropyl group (1-methylethyl) at the para position. This substitution can influence the compound's reactivity and solubility. The presence of the methyl group on the propanoyl backbone suggests steric hindrance, which may affect its reactivity in acylation reactions. Overall, this compound is likely to be used in organic synthesis, particularly in the preparation of esters or amides, due to its electrophilic nature. Safety precautions should be taken when handling this compound, as acyl chlorides can be corrosive and may release harmful gases upon reaction with water or alcohols.
